FIRST YEAR | ||
First Semester | Hours | |
CIS-156 | Computer Logic CIS-156This course is an introduction to basic computer programming terms and concepts. JavaScript is used to illustrate variables, conditional statements, functions, loops, and arrays. (Repeatable 3 Times)
| 3.0 |
CIS-160 | Practical Software Application CIS-160Provides an opportunity for students to learn computer concepts and to use word processing, spreadsheet, database management, and presentation software. (Repeatable 3 Times)
| 3.0 |
CIS-071 | Introduction to Networking CIS-071An overview of computer hardware, software, networks, Internet, web applications, systems, security and troubleshooting. To be used as an introduction to the Network Administration program or to supplement another computer-related degree. (Repeatable 2 Times)
| 2.0 |
CIS-099 | Introduction to Web Technology CIS-099This introductory course teaches web page design principles, including proper use of HTML5 and CSS3 and introductory JavaScript.
| 3.0 |
CIS-060 | Project Management CIS-060An overview of project management as it applies to information technology projects. Project management software will be introduced. (Repeatable 2 Times)
| 2.0 |
Semester Totals |
13.0 | |
Second Semester | ||
ITT-054 | Mobile Application Development * +++ITT-054This course is a study of mobile device programming. Development of mobile applications including user interfaces, user input, variables, icons, decision making, lists, arrays, web browsers, audio, pictures, tablets, animation, Google maps, and publishing are covered. (Repeatable 3 times)
| 3.0 |
CIS-052 | Visual Basic * +CIS-052Continuation of fundamentals of programming including selection,iteration, and condition structures. Introduction to graphical interface(s) and object-oriented, event-driven applications requiring the use of events, arrays, classes, inheritance, file handling, error handling and more. Also includes ASP.NET applications and ADO.NET applications. (Repeatable 3 Times)
| 4.0 |
CIS-162 | Object-Oriented Programming I * +++CIS-162This course teaches the fundamentals of object-oriented programming. It builds on the concepts of data types, functions, arrays, programming structures and debugging from CIS 156 Computer Logic while introducing classes, objects, encapsulation and modular design using the C# language. (Repeatable 3 Times)
| 3.0 |
ITT-044 | IT Programming Cert Internship *ITT-044This course gives IT-Programming students on-the-job experience. Students must work in a computer related area approved by their advisor. (Repeatable 3 Times)
| 1.0 |
CIS or ITT | Electives **CIS or ITT
| 6.0 |
Semester Totals |
17.0 |
Total Program Hours | 30.0 |